With its expansive two-sided opening and stunningly realistic fire presentation, the Montebello See-Through provides a harmonious flow from one space to another, inside or outside the home. The Montebello See-Through is available in a 40" size, and comes standard with high-definition logs, ceramic ember bed burner, log grate, wire mesh pull screens and the Total Comfort Control™System.
Aesthetics
Smooth-faced design features ceramic glass for optimum heat transfer.
Dramatic louverless construction gives the fireplace a clean, traditional masonry look and provides the ability to finish right up to the opening.
Tall ceramic-glass opening provides an exceptional view of the logs and flame.
The high-definition charred split-oak log set is cast from real wood for an authentic look.
Platinum embers enhance the glow of the fire.
Light- and dark-tinted outdoor kits trimmed in stainless steel are available for indoor/outdoor application. The dark-tinted version provides enhanced ambiance from inside the room by creating an infinity effect while reducing glare from the outside environment.
Comfort
Exclusive Secure Vent™ chimney system provides efficient venting.
Rated 68% in annual fuel utilization efficiency (AFUE).
Ease of Operation
Total Comfort Control™ features a full-function remote control with thermostatic function, six flame settings, standard pilot override capability and smart mode which modulates flame to maintain desired room temperature.
Gas controls are conveniently located to the side of the fireplace opening for easy installation and operation.
An adjustable air shutter is included in the burner which allows you to raise or lower flame height to desired levels.
Design Versatility
A required choice of six liners available in Architectural Stone, Venetian Tile, Buff Rustic, Buff Herringbone, Black Rustic, and Black Porcelain.
Optional andirons evoke the look of a traditional hearth, in Mission and Classic styles.
Decorative freestanding screens in a variety of designs are available.
Available in power-vented versions which can vent up to 110 ft.
Can be installed as an indoor/indoor unit or as an indoor/outdoor unit with the addition of an outdoor kit.
This fireplace meets all 2015 ANSI barrier requirements.

Raft Island Kitchen Redesign & Remodel
Project Overview
Located in the beautiful Puget Sound this project began with functionality in mind. The original kitchen was built custom for a very tall person, The custom countertops were not functional for the busy family that purchased the home. The new design has clean lines with elements of nature . The custom oak cabinets were locally made. The stain is a custom blend. The reclaimed island was made from local material. ..the floating shelves and beams are also reclaimed lumber. The island counter top and hood is NEOLITH in Iron Copper , a durable porcelain counter top material The counter tops along the perimeter of the kitchen is Lapitec. The design is original, textured, inviting, brave & complimentary.

Established in 1895 as a warehouse for the spice trade, 481 Washington was built to last. With its 25-inch-thick base and enchanting Beaux Arts facade, this regal structure later housed a thriving Hudson Square printing company. After an impeccable renovation, the magnificent loft building’s original arched windows and exquisite cornice remain a testament to the grandeur of days past. Perfectly anchored between Soho and Tribeca, Spice Warehouse has been converted into 12 spacious full-floor lofts that seamlessly fuse old-world character with modern convenience.
Steps from the Hudson River, Spice Warehouse is within walking distance of renowned restaurants, famed art galleries, specialty shops and boutiques. With its golden sunsets and outstanding facilities, this is the ideal destination for those seeking the tranquil pleasures of the Hudson River waterfront.
Expansive private floor residences were designed to be both versatile and functional, each with 3- to 4-bedrooms, 3 full baths, and a home office. Several residences enjoy dramatic Hudson River views.
This open space has been designed to accommodate a perfect Tribeca city lifestyle for entertaining, relaxing and working.
This living room design reflects a tailored “old-world” look, respecting the original features of the Spice Warehouse. With its high ceilings, arched windows, original brick wall and iron columns, this space is a testament of ancient time and old world elegance.
The design choices are a combination of neutral, modern finishes such as the Oak natural matte finish floors and white walls, white shaker style kitchen cabinets, combined with a lot of texture found in the brick wall, the iron columns and the various fabrics and furniture pieces finishes used throughout the space and highlighted by a beautiful natural light brought in through a wall of arched windows.
The layout is open and flowing to keep the feel of grandeur of the space so each piece and design finish can be admired individually.
As soon as you enter, a comfortable Eames lounge chair invites you in, giving her back to a solid brick wall adorned by the “cappuccino” art photography piece by Francis Augustine and surrounded by flowing linen taupe window drapes and a shiny cowhide rug.
The cream linen sectional sofa takes center stage, with its sea of textures pillows, giving it character, comfort and uniqueness. The living room combines modern lines such as the Hans Wegner Shell chairs in walnut and black fabric with rustic elements such as this one of a kind Indonesian antique coffee table, giant iron antique wall clock and hand made jute rug which set the old world tone for an exceptional interior.

The Envy™ Direct-Vent Fireplace is sure to provide the perfect foundation for custom tailoring to your taste and home's décor. Both looks offer an expansive ceramic-glass opening and patent-pending FullFlame™ dual burner technology for exceptional glow and flame appearance. With a wide array of optional accessories to personalize to your taste, the Envy provides endless possibilities for making your living area warm and inviting.
Aesthetics
Smooth-faced design features ceramic glass for optimum heat transfer.
Available in Traditional (with log set) and Contemporary (with glass media) configurations.
Exclusive Full Flame™ burner technology independently optimizes fuel mixture to generate superior glow and flame.
Standard fireplace lighting illuminates interior with 6 distinct settings.
Realistic Hi-Definition logs molded from actual firewood to deliver the look of natural fire.
Massive viewing area combined with a ceramic glass enclosure panel provide an exceptional view of the fire.
Contemporary units feature glossy black porcelain interior to amplify the look of the flame.
Barrier integrates seamlessly with surrounding trim and provides an unobstructed view of the fire while providing an additional level of safety.
Comfort
Exclusive Full Flame™ burner technology combines a highly efficient combustion system with a greater range of control to optimize heat output.
Full Flame™ multi stage burner and full function remote provide a total of 12 distinct flame settings.
Hi performance modulating blower with noise canceling ducting for quietly delivering heat to the living space.
Intermittent pilot ignition includes battery backup to provide continued operation in the event of a power outage.
Full function control features standing pilot mode for improved performance in extreme climates.
Ease of Operation
Full featured modulating remote controls all fireplace functions as well as a smart thermostat mode for optimum comfort and efficiency.
Gas controls are conveniently located to the side of the fireplace opening for easy installation and operation
Design Versatility
Available in Traditional (with log set) and Contemporary (with glass media) configurations.
Traditional
Realistic Hi-Definition logs molded from actual firewood to deliver the look of natural fire.
Choice of two realistic ceramic brick fireplace liners for the true look of masonry craftsmanship to complete the traditional look.
Optional andirons and free-standing fire screens allow for further customization.
Contemporary
Dual burner technology for the ultimate flame control.
Smooth porcelain interior liners complete the contemporary look while showcasing and reflecting the tall dramatic flame.
Choice of five glass media colors to suit your taste and complement any home decor.
Optional facades to further customize to taste.
This fireplace meets all 2015 ANSI barrier requirements.

THE SETUP
Once these empty nest homeowners decided to stay put, they knew a new kitchen was in order. Passionate about cooking, entertaining, and hosting holiday gatherings, they found their existing kitchen inadequate. The space, with its traditional style and outdated layout, was far from ideal. They longed for an elegant, timeless kitchen that was not only show-stopping but also functional, seamlessly catering to both their daily routines and special occasions with friends and family. Another key factor was its future appeal to potential buyers, as they’re ready to enjoy their new kitchen while also considering downsizing in the future.
Design Objectives:
Create a more streamlined, open space
Eliminate traditional elements
Improve flow for entertaining and everyday use
Omit dated posts and soffits
Include storage for small appliances to keep counters clutter-free
Address mail organization and phone charging concerns
THE REMODEL
Design Challenges:
Compensate for lost storage from omitted wall cabinets
Revise floorplan to feature a single, spacious island
Enhance island seating proximity for a more engaging atmosphere
Address awkward space above existing built-ins
Improve natural light blocked by wall cabinet near the window
Create a highly functional space tailored for entertaining
Design Solutions:
Tall cabinetry and pull-outs maximize storage efficiency
A generous single island promotes seamless flow and ample prep space
Strategic island seating arrangement fosters easy conversation
New built-ins fill arched openings, ensuring a custom, clutter-free look
Replace wall cabinet with lighted open shelves for an airy feel
Galley Dresser and Workstation offer impeccable organization and versatility, creating the perfect setup for entertaining with everything easily accessible.
THE RENEWED SPACE
The new kitchen exceeded every expectation, thrilling the clients with its revitalized, expansive design and thoughtful functionality. The transformation brought to life an open space adorned with marble accents, a state-of-the-art steam oven, and the seamless integration of the Galley Dresser, crafting a kitchen not just to be used, but to be cherished. This is more than a culinary space; it’s a new heart of their home, ready to host countless memories and culinary adventures.

Our clients called us wanting to not only update their master bathroom but to specifically make it more functional. She had just had knee surgery, so taking a shower wasn’t easy. They wanted to remove the tub and enlarge the shower, as much as possible, and add a bench. She really wanted a seated makeup vanity area, too. They wanted to replace all vanity cabinets making them one height, and possibly add tower storage. With the current layout, they felt that there were too many doors, so we discussed possibly using a barn door to the bedroom.
We removed the large oval bathtub and expanded the shower, with an added bench. She got her seated makeup vanity and it’s placed between the shower and the window, right where she wanted it by the natural light. A tilting oval mirror sits above the makeup vanity flanked with Pottery Barn “Hayden” brushed nickel vanity lights. A lit swing arm makeup mirror was installed, making for a perfect makeup vanity! New taller Shiloh “Eclipse” bathroom cabinets painted in Polar with Slate highlights were installed (all at one height), with Kohler “Caxton” square double sinks. Two large beautiful mirrors are hung above each sink, again, flanked with Pottery Barn “Hayden” brushed nickel vanity lights on either side. Beautiful Quartzmasters Polished Calacutta Borghini countertops were installed on both vanities, as well as the shower bench top and shower wall cap.
Carrara Valentino basketweave mosaic marble tiles was installed on the shower floor and the back of the niches, while Heirloom Clay 3x9 tile was installed on the shower walls. A Delta Shower System was installed with both a hand held shower and a rainshower. The linen closet that used to have a standard door opening into the middle of the bathroom is now storage cabinets, with the classic Restoration Hardware “Campaign” pulls on the drawers and doors. A beautiful Birch forest gray 6”x 36” floor tile, laid in a random offset pattern was installed for an updated look on the floor. New glass paneled doors were installed to the closet and the water closet, matching the barn door. A gorgeous Shades of Light 20” “Pyramid Crystals” chandelier was hung in the center of the bathroom to top it all off!
The bedroom was painted a soothing Magnetic Gray and a classic updated Capital Lighting “Harlow” Chandelier was hung for an updated look.
We were able to meet all of our clients needs by removing the tub, enlarging the shower, installing the seated makeup vanity, by the natural light, right were she wanted it and by installing a beautiful barn door between the bathroom from the bedroom! Not only is it beautiful, but it’s more functional for them now and they love it!
